In-depth case review

Michael Reese Coffman was convicted in the United States District Court for the Northern District of Florida in 2005 of conspiracy to distribute and possession with intent to distribute 500 grams or more of a mixture and substance containing methamphetamine, in violation of 21 U.S.C. § 841(a)(1), (b)(1)(A)(viii), and § 846. He was sentenced to 120 months of supervised release. On December 18, 2015, President Barack Obama granted Coffman a commutation of his sentence.
